Wrath of Man follows a new, guarded security guard (Statham) working on an armored car. When a robbery occurs, he surprises everyone with hidden talents, leaving his colleagues to question his identity and motives. They soon learn he’s driven by a personal vendetta and is determined to get revenge.
It’s Violent, Action Camp At Its Most Fun
Critics gave Wrath of Man a 67% rating on Rotten Tomatoes, but audiences loved it, giving it a 90% score on Popcornmeter. Most viewers agree it’s classic Jason Statham – full of intense action, violence, and pure entertainment. Denise Pieniazek of Puesta En Escena notes that while the film is based on the 2004 French movie Le Convoyeur, director Guy Ritchie has completely reimagined the story, changing its overall feel and style. Keith Garlington of Keith and the Movies agrees, saying the film maintains a consistently dark and serious tone, with complex characters, and that Statham is perfectly suited to Ritchie’s gritty world.
